我正在对gridviews进行内联编辑,并且需要将gridview中所有行的所有数据发布回服务器。我一直在做一些研究,每个成功的人都会做到以下几点:
var gridData = $("#jqGridTable").jqGrid('getGridParam', 'data');
var jsonData = JSON.stringify(gridData);
$.ajax({
url: '@Url.Action("AddQRC")',
type: "POST",
data: {
jqGridData: jsonData
},
dataType: "json",
success: submitFormSuccess,
error: submitFormFailure
});
我将数据类型设置为local并将loadonce设置为true。出于某种原因,当我提交数据时,只有gridview的第一行被发送回服务器。你们知道我可能会缺少什么吗?